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Summe mehrere Tabellen

Forumthread: Summe mehrere Tabellen

Summe mehrere Tabellen
07.02.2003 14:40:26
johannes
Hallo Ihr da drausen,
ich summiere aus mehreren Tabellen die von 01 - 12 durchbenannt sind ( Monate) in einer anderen Tabellendie gleiche Zelle. Hierzu verwende ich die Formel =SUMME('01:12'!C5).

Nun der Knackpunkt: Ich möchte z. B. in Zelle A1--> 01 und A2--> 06 eingeben um so eine von bis Auswahl zu bekommen und so die Summierung flexibel zu halten.
Ich habe nach einen Tip versucht die Formel mit =Indirekt zu erweitern, aber ich bekomme es nicht hin und ich weis nicht warum!

Kann mir irgendjemand da drausen helfen.

Vielen Dank Johannes


Anzeige

5
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
Re: Summe mehrere Tabellen
07.02.2003 15:08:20
M@x

Hallo Johannes, ich bin auch drinnen
mir ist nicht klar ob ich dich richtig verstanden habe:
'=SUMME('01:12'!A1:A2).

Gruss

M@x

Re: Summe mehrere Tabellen
07.02.2003 15:11:44
Johannes

Hallo M@x,

die werte in den Zellen A1 und A2 sollen für Tabellennamen stehen!

Im Prinzip =SUMME('A1:A2'!C5)


Johannes

Re: Summe mehrere Tabellen
07.02.2003 19:43:21
Boris

Hi Johannes,

mir fällt derzeit nur eine ARRAY-Variante über INDIREKT ein, da ich es - komischerweise - auch nicht anders gelöst bekomme.

Du willst aus Tabelle x bis y jeweils A1 summieren.
Die Zahl der Starttabelle steht in B1 (z.B. 1), die der Endtabelle in C1 (z.B. 5) - liefert die Summe aus A1 aus Tabelle1 bis Tabelle5:

Dann diese Array-Formel:

{=SUMME(N(INDIREKT("Tabelle"&ZEILE(INDIREKT(B1&":"&C1))&"!A1")))}

Die {geschweiften Klammern} nicht mit eingeben, sondern die Formeleingabe mit Strg-Shift-Enter abschließen. So werden sie automatisch erzeugt.

Gruß Boris


Anzeige
Lösung mit VBA
07.02.2003 21:47:22
Lutz

Hallo Johannes,
hier eine Lösung mit VBA:


//Werte aus vorgegebenen Blättern summieren//

Sub Werte_einlesen()
' Werte aus Zelle A1 derjenigen Blätter summieren,
' die im aktiven Blatt in A2 bis B2 festgelegt werden


Dim iCounter, sum As Integer
sum = 0
For iCounter = Range("A2").Value To Range("B2").Value
sum = sum + Worksheets(iCounter).Range("A1").Value
Next iCounter
Range("C2").Value = sum

End Sub

Gruß Lutz



Anzeige
Re: Summe mehrere Tabellen
10.02.2003 16:58:54
johannes

Hallo Boris,

kommt ein wenig spät, aber trotzdem vielen Dank für deine Hilfe (für beide Foren)!

Es funktioniert problemlos!

Gruß Johannes

;

Forumthreads zu verwandten Themen

Anzeige
Anzeige
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ige